Berry Phase Effects in the dynamics of Dirac Electrons in Doubly Special Relativity Framework

arXiv:0709.0579 · doi:10.1016/j.physletb.2007.11.041

Abstract

We consider the Doubly Special Relativity (DSR) generalization of Dirac equation in an external potential in the Magueijo-Smolin base. The particles obey a modified energy-momentum dispersion relation. The semiclassical diagonalization of the Dirac Hamiltonian reveals the intrinsic Berry phase effects in the particle dynamics.
